    Bioelectronic Sensors Market Summary

    The Global Bioelectronic Sensors Market is projected to grow significantly from 40.2 USD Billion in 2024 to 110.1 USD Billion by 2035.

    Key Market Trends & Highlights

    Bioelectronic Sensors Key Trends and Highlights

    • The market is expected to experience a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.6 percent from 2025 to 2035.
    • By 2035, the market valuation is anticipated to reach 110.1 USD Billion, reflecting robust growth potential.
    • In 2024, the market is valued at 40.2 USD Billion, indicating a strong foundation for future expansion.
    • Growing adoption of bioelectronic sensors due to increasing demand for advanced healthcare monitoring solutions is a major market driver.

    Market Size & Forecast

    2024 Market Size 40.2 (USD Billion)
    2035 Market Size 110.1 (USD Billion)
    CAGR (2025-2035) 9.6%

    Major Players

    Salvia Bioelectronics, LifeSensors, OmniVision Technologies Inc., AgaMatrix Inc., Sensirion AG, Broadcom Inc., Sotera Wireless, F. Hoffmann-La Roche AG, Medtronic plc

    Bioelectronic Sensors Market Trends

    Wearable Gadget Adoption is Propelling Market Growth

    The adoption of wearable devices is driving the market CAGR for bioelectronic sensors. Consumers are becoming interested in wearable gadgets such as fitness trackers, smartwatches, and health monitoring devices. Bioelectronic sensors are frequently used in these devices to monitor physiological factors such as heart rate, sleep patterns, and activity levels. Wearable gadgets have become a popular alternative for people who wish to track their health and fitness in real time due to its ease of use and accessibility.

    The use of bioelectronic sensors in these gadgets enables users to collect vital data about their general well-being and make informed lifestyle and healthcare decisions.

    Furthermore, healthcare practitioners are beginning to recognize the value of wearable gadgets and bioelectronic sensors in remote patient monitoring and preventive care. Using these sensors, healthcare personnel can remotely monitor patients' health, discover early warning indications, and respond quickly if necessary. The growing demand for wearable devices, as well as the incorporation of bioelectronic sensors in these devices, is propelling the Bioelectronic Sensors Market forward. This trend is projected to continue as technology progresses, allowing wearable devices to have more precise and advanced sensor capabilities.

    Additionally, as technology advances, so does the opportunity for healthcare industry innovation. More sophisticated bioelectronic sensors have opened up new avenues for medical diagnostics, therapy, and patient care. With increased accuracy and precision, these sophisticated sensors can now gather and evaluate a wide range of physiological data. This helps healthcare practitioners to make more informed decisions and give patients with more individualized treatment. Bioelectronic sensors integrated into medical devices and equipment have substantially increased the efficiency and effectiveness of healthcare practices.

    Furthermore, the growing emphasis on preventative healthcare and early disease diagnosis has increased demand for non-invasive and continuous monitoring systems. Bioelectronic sensors, which enable real-time monitoring of vital signs, biomarkers, and other health data, are playing a critical role in addressing this demand.

    Collaborations among technology firms, healthcare providers, and research institutes have also hastened the development and commercialization of bioelectronic sensor technologies. These collaborations create creativity, drive research and development, and contribute to market growth overall.

    The integration of bioelectronic sensors into healthcare systems appears to enhance patient monitoring and disease management, potentially revolutionizing the way medical data is collected and analyzed.

    Market Segment Insights

    Bioelectronic Sensors Type Insights

    The Bioelectronic Sensors Market segmentation, based on type includes bio-electronic devices, bio-electronic medicine. The market is expected to be dominated by the bio-electronic medicine category. The gradually expanding needs for personalized or adaptable medication, as well as the rapidly rising R&D efforts to build novel bioelectronics, are driving revenue growth in this market. Another element driving this market's rapid revenue growth is the advancement of implantable bioelectronics technology, which offers enormous potential for the creation of enhanced and efficient equipment for personalized electronic pharmaceuticals.

    Bioelectronic Sensors Product Insights

    The Bioelectronic Sensors Market segmentation, based on Product, includes electrochemical biosensors, piezoelectric biosensors, thermal biosensors and optical biosensors. Electrochemical biosensors are expected to dominate the Global Bioelectronics Market. The cell-based electrochemical biosensor contributes significantly to biology, medicine, chemistry, pharmacology, and environmental studies. As recognition components, these biosensors utilize whole cells and electrochemical transducers, extending biosensing and life science research.

    Bioelectronic Sensors Application Insights

    The Bioelectronic Sensors Market segmentation, based on application, includes biochips, implantable devices, prosthetics, artificial organs, molecular motors and others. The implantable device category has the biggest revenue share in the market. This segment's rapid revenue development can be attributable to the exponentially expanding demand for technologically sophisticated implanted medical devices, such as ear implants, pacemakers, and even stomach implants. With improved research, substantial advancements in technology led in the development of implanted devices such as neuromodulation devices for chronic pain management, wirelessly powered devices to help organ functions, and stimulation devices for rapid bone restoration.

    These variables are accountable for this segment's domination and, as a result, the market's revenue growth.

    Regional Insights

    By region, the study provides the market insights into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ific and Rest of the World. North America will have the world's largest bioelectronics market. The increasing usage of bioelectronics in numerous healthcare domains promotes market expansion in this region.

    Furthermore, the presence of a significant number of R&D facilities, the increased adoption of refined and advanced products by healthcare professionals, clinicians, and patients, and the rise in cases of several serious diseases (such as cardiovascular diseases, cancer, and psychological disorders) due to sedentary lifestyles are expected to drive revenue growth in the North American Bioelectronics Market during the forecast period.

    Further, the major countries studied in the market report are the US, Canada, German, France, the UK, Italy, Spain, China, Japan, India, Australia, South Korea, and Brazil.

    Europe Bioelectronic Sensors Market accounts for the second-largest market share because of the presence of key industry actors, as well as the early acceptance and development of bioelectronics. Further, the German Bioelectronic Sensors Market held the largest market share, and the UK Bioelectronic Sensors Market was the fastest growing market in the European region

    The Asia-Pacific Bioelectronic Sensors Market is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R from 2023 to 2032. This is due to development in healthcare infrastructure as well as quick economic expansion throughout the course of the projection period. Moreover, China’s Bioelectronic Sensors Market held the largest market share, and the Indian Bioelectronic Sensors Market was the fastest growing market in the Asia-Pacific region.

    F. Hoffmann-La Roche AG, better known as Roche, is a Swiss global healthcare firm with two divisions: pharmaceuticals and diagnostics. Roche Holding AG, its holding company, has shares listed on the SIX Swiss Exchange. The company's headquarters are in Basel. Roche is the world's fifth-largest pharmaceutical firm by sales and the world's top provider of cancer therapies. In February 2019, The firm stated that it will purchase Spark Therapeutics for US$4.3 billion ($114.50 per share), adding Spark's gene therapy portfolio to its previously acquired assets. Spark already has an authorized medication for Leber's congenital amaurosis, Luxturna, which costs $850,000 per patient.

    Medtronic plc is a medical device firm based in the United States. Because of its 2015 acquisition of Irish-based Covidien, the company's operational and executive offices are in Minneapolis, Minnesota, and its legal headquarters are in Ireland. While it is headquartered in the United States, it has operations in over 150 countries and employs over 90,000 people. It creates and produces healthcare technology and therapies. In April 2022, Medtronic plc established a collaboration with GE Healthcare to meet the requirements and demands of Ambulatory Surgery Centres.

    Medtronic established a strategic alliance with CathWorks, a coronary artery disease (CAD) technology company, in July. Medtronic has the option to buy CathWorks in the future under a separate arrangement.

    Industry Developments

    In January 2022, The Alliance for Advancing Bioelectronic Medicine organized the first Bioelectronic Medicine Day, which featured a health awareness campaign. The initiative assisted efforts and breakthroughs in the field of bioelectronic medicine.

    In June 2021, The FDA has authorized Medtronic's (Ireland) Vanta spinal cord stimulator. The new device uses Medtronic's AdaptiveStim technology to give tailored pain management that responds to a patient's movement or body position through an in-built accelerometer.

    In January 2020, Medtronic plc (Ireland) has purchased Stimgenics, a pioneer in Differential Target Multiplexed, a revolutionary spinal cord stimulation therapy that is now available on the market.
